Address 0 PPC

PM733DBTKf6o9zq98PPF6kLKxNXxhmVNxg

Confirmed

Total Received349811.948603 PPC
Total Sent349811.948603 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PM733DBTKf6o9zq98PPF6kLKxNXxhmVNxg349811.948603 PPC
Fee: 0.01 PPC
392716 Confirmations349811.938603 PPC
PM733DBTKf6o9zq98PPF6kLKxNXxhmVNxg349811.948603 PPC
PK8LgNE4KKTELJfeDyB9MR9h6veY7aegeU685.7982 PPC
Fee: 0.01 PPC
392729 Confirmations350497.746803 PPC